The calculated horsepower of a screw conveyor may need to be adjusted so the drive unit will have more horsepower and torque available to overcome an upset condition such as a minor choke in the inlet or a large lump being conveyed. Vertical Screw Conveyors: Taking Up Less Space. As the name suggests, vertical screw conveyors are designed to elevate bulk materials in a vertical direction efficiently. They feature a tightly coiled screw within a vertical housing. Material enters at the bottom and is steadily pushed upwards by the screw rotation for discharge at the top.

Screw conveyors are structurally reinforced at the ends by the use of end lugs which are welded to the non-carrying side of the flights so that material flow will not be obstructed. The force that the material does not rotate with the screw conveyor blades is the material's own weight and the frictional resistance of the screw conveyor casing to the material. A spiral screw or auger conveyor usually consist of a tube containing either a spiral blade or flighting coiled around a shaft, to move liquids, slurries or granular materials horizontally or at a slight incline as an efficient way. The rate of volume transfer is proportional to the rotation rate of the shaft.
